TANKS a starfire 180g in the house drilled thru the wall plumbing (wife is thrilled), in the garage I have 2 x 212g glass flats from the old Oculus warehouse and a 200g sump.....

SUMP 200g three chambers middle chamber is a fuge approximately 65g filled with different macro, also any strange crabs I have found over the years...(scary place in there) also have some new baby Banggi Cardinals swimming in there (successful breeding on those guys), sump has at least 200lbs of live rock and a G6 skimmer with 6 carbon reactors and a vertex bio pellet reactor and a 60w UV sterilizer....

FLOW main system is on a reef flo and a little giant, power heads 6 wp 40s and a par of tunzis and a pair of Korallia

LIGHTS: Display has three 250w HQI and two t12 460 bulbs and two 180w Chinese leds blue, flat #1 has 4 x AI Hydras and flat #2 is equipped with Aqautic life pro 246w leds and three Chinese 120w leds, fuge has two 15w leds blue andwhite

MAINTENANCE: is fairly easy for this size, flesh water top offs almost daily, 2-5g also 180g weekly water changes and monthly carbon changes....I DOSE NOTHING....I use natural sea water all my level are the same as the ocean as you can imagine....

FISH: 5 yellow tangs
unicorn tang
vlamingi tang
lavender tang
sail fin tang
3 copperband butterflys
3 six lines
yellow choris wrasse
malanarus wrasse
potters wrasse
lubbok wrasse
several watchman gobies and various gobies
20 green chromis
three pairs of diff Anthias
breeding pair of Mandarin Gobies
breeding pair of Banggi Cardinals and several in my flats (and lots of little tiny guys swimming in the sump)
4 lawnmowers
pair on Picasso clowns
2 pair of Clarkii clowns
various shrimps, crabs and snails..................

TANKS:: 120G waiting to be put into action, main display is a 65G marineland RR tank, 2 Shallow tanks in the basement both connected , Frag/ Bubble tip tank 60GRR DB 48x24x12 and 30G DB 24x24x24

LIGHTING:: 65G display has 2 Evergrow IT2040's run from 7am morning turn off 11pm night time, there ran on a program that Gab setup for a sunrise sunset feature. The 2 Shallows have 2 ATI fixtures, one is 48" 8bulbs ATI and a 24" ATI 8 bulb. Ran for 11am till 6:30pm.

Filtration:: reef octopus NWB-110 for the 65G display, for the Shallow growout system we have a Reef Octopus Diablo DCS 150 DC Internal Protein Skimmer . run carbon threw 2 little fishes reactors on both tanks. filter sock changed out weekly, we do not reuse socks on either tank.

FISH::
65G display: 2 Borbonius anthias, pair of sanjay Black Photon's, Sunburst Anthias, Yellow coris wrasse, Royal Gamma, Six Line wrasse, 2 Mandrian's and a SoHal Tang.

30G DB shallow:: Pair of spawning Black Ice , Grade A SnowFlake and a type of Goby i forgot the type.

60G DB shallow:: Grade A Black Ice, Grade A Wyoming White, Six Line Wrasse, Stary Blenny and a single Mandrian.

FLOW 65G Display:: 2 MP10 WES

FLOW 60G DB Shallow:: 2 WP 25 one set on ELSE mode S1 , other is on W1 / S2

FLOW 30G DB Shallow:: 1 WP25 Front corner pointed towards the back set at W1 S1 Knob pointed in the North position.


Maintenance is easy just weekly water changes and changing of the filter socks on all tanks , clean out the skimmer cup's and clean all glass on the tanks.

Template:

Tank info: Deep Blue 60cube and 80 frag
Sump: diy sumb
Refugium: 10*10*9
Skimmer: swc 160 and sc301
Flow: gyre riptide in cube( love it) wp25 and koralia evo 1500
Lighting: coralux t5/Led 8 bulb over cube and 6 bulb over frag
Dosing/caRx: Kalk with vinegar, 2 part when needed and aquavitro fuel twice a week.
Controller if any: none
Maintenance info: change 5 gallons a week in both tanks
Stock list: Yellow tang, purple tang, anthias, wrasses
